If you are looking for a simple and elegant appetizer for your next party, try this Pear Walnut Pomegranate Baked Brie. It is a warm and gooey cheese topped with fresh fruit, crunchy nuts, and a drizzle of Pomegranate Dark Balsamic. It is easy to make and sure to impress your guests.

Ingredients

 1 wheel of Brie
  cup dried cranberries
 ¼ walnuts, chopped
 1 medium pear, diced to

Directions

1

Preheat oven to 350° F.

2

Slice the top rind of the brie with a sharp knife scoring in a criss cross direction.

3

Place the brie in a brie baker or oven-proof shallow dish.

Brie Topping
4

Combine pear, walnuts, cranberries and Pomegranate Dark Balsamic in a small saucepan.

5

Cook 5 minutes on medium heat, stirring with a wooden spoon until pomegranate becomes thicker thus reduces.

6

Pour the pear walnut pomegranate reduction over the brie and bake for 10 - 15 minutes.

7

Enjoy with a crusty bread, crostinis or crackers.
